#f46930 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f46930 is composed of 95.7% red, 41.2% green and 18.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 57% magenta, 80.3%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 17.4 degrees, a saturation of 89.9% and a lightness of 57.3%. #f46930 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d260 with #e90000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6633.

#f46930 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f46930 has RGB values of R:244, G:105, B:48 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.57, Y:0.8,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 16017712.

Shades and Tints of #f46930
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110501 is the darkest color, while #fffd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#f46930
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#98908c is the less saturated color, while #fc6528 is the most saturated one.
